Q. Why can it be attainable to form into some PDF sorts instead of in Other individuals? Is there any way to fill out all PDF varieties on the pc while not having to print them out?
A. Some PDF data files are established to accept and conserve the textual content you type in in your Computer system. These interactive PDF data files are usually called “fillable,” and they can be created with many applications, which includes Adobe Acrobat or Microsoft Term. Static or “flat” types that don't acknowledge textual content input are often scans of paper documents or information supposed for printing.
But although a type is flat, you might be able to increase your own personal text working with diverse courses.
Though you'll be able to include reviews and notes to files, the no cost Adobe Reader software program are not able to enter and preserve textual content on its own Unless of course the form was designed to generally be fillable. People with the entire Adobe Acrobat method, although, can utilize the Typewriter selection. In the latest variations of Acrobat, underneath the Instruments menu on the best side from the monitor, go to the Content material menu and select “Increase or Edit Textual content Box” for getting to the Typewriter Device, then click on into the shape fields and begin typing.
The total Model of Adobe Acrobat XI Professional expenditures $450 and even though a cost-free thirty-working day demo is offered to obtain, you'll find other approaches to fill in flat PDF varieties. In lots of situations, Mac consumers can make use of the free Preview application that comes along with OS X; the app can typically understand text fields in sorts and contains textual content annotation instruments, While some people report needing to resave the file to be a PDF so other packages can begin to see the textual content.
A lot of other third-occasion PDF-editing applications are across the World-wide-web. Some alternatives include things like PDF-XChange Editor (absolutely free to try, $44 for the full Edition), the absolutely free Foxit Reader or Nitro PDF Reader for Home windows, or even the $8 PDF Sort Filler for Mac.

Idea From the 7 days Phishing cons, All those misleading e-mail messages that seek to trick end users into revealing personalized data, are a regular on line danger. Alerting your webmail service provider into the fraudulent messages has gotten less complicated, as many companies consist of crafted-in applications to report phishing scams.
In Yahoo Mail, turn on the checkbox close to the information and beneath the Spam menu at the very best of the mailbox window, decide on “Report as phishing scam.” In Microsoft’s Outlook.com, pick out the concept while in the Inbox window, and underneath the Junk menu at the highest from the monitor, pick “Phishing fraud.” In Google’s Gmail, Using the message open on display screen, click on the menu arrow close to the Reply button and opt for “Report phishing” in the listing. Apple’s iCloud webmail does not have a dedicated menu for alerting the organization to phishing, but implies forwarding the mail to [email protected]. J.D. BIERSDORFER
